The City of Dallas has proposed the FY 15-16 City Budget. This proposal coincides with 40 public meetings which provides citizens with the opportunity to offer feedback to City Council.

In a survey of residents last year, the City of Dallas asked citizens to share their priorities in addition to meeting with City Council to understand their vision for the future of Dallas. The City has responded with a balanced budget that invests in improving street conditions; code compliance and animal services; arts and libraries; technology to give citizens greater access to information; as well as, revitalizing neighborhoods throughout Dallas and continuing our commitment to Public Safety.

Throughout the budget process, the City was able to compile a list of 7 priorities for this year’s budget: Technology, Infrastructure, Code Compliance, Police Services, C.A.R.E, Efficiencies and Cost Reductions, and Neighborhoods. In addition, City Services, Workforce Impacts, Dallas Water Utilities and Sanitation Services were indicated as areas of importance.
